Great question.

Depends on your business model - if you are going to do a paysite then you want to hold onto your material and avoid letting the masses get it unless a customer pays. Strategic marketing via tube sites and limited licensing to VOD (like Clips4Sale, PPV models) will bring in a good stream of money. Content is king, if you have something that is hot and will sell i'd recommend a paysite - people always want something unique. If you are going to do generic content without some kind of hook i'd go all routes to recoup/profit.
